SML’s Planning Minute will provide brief yet thought-provoking financial planning ideas for individuals, families, business owners and executives. Topics cover a broad range of issues including personal financial planning, retirement planning, life insurance protection planning, estate tax and liquidity planning, business planning, business succession planning, and more.

Minimizing Capital Gains Tax on the Sale of a Business














Minimizing Capital Gains Tax on the Sale of a Business


































Episode 355 - Business owners selling a business are often worried about capital gains tax. There are several strategies that may help to minimize or avoid capital gains.
